I've got a 1994 Alpha 1 gen II with 190 hrs on it thats overheating - 1994 Se Ray 25' Express Cruiser - Its a raw water system - Bought boat used - When test run, no problems, got to 140 held temp at idle or WOT - Prop on it had some nicks so had the dealer put a 17p on it - Ran it first time out and temp got to 160 and then held - Replaced impeller and housing & thermostat - Replaced 17p prop with a 15p (per Sea Ray recomm)and took her out - Temp went to 180 and rising when underway - At idle or in neutral making 2500 - 3000 rpms, stays on 140 with no problem and is moving lots of water - Could this be an exhaust in the water intake / ventilation problem?
